Adventure Staff
Description

SUMMARY OF POSITION:

Fulfill the overall ministry of Grace Adventures and implement the mission of summer camps. Maintain and run a variety of programmed activities and activity sites to serve campers and guests.

GENERAL R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Help run camps, retreats, trainings and Community Worship programs with excellence 
  • Complete the course of study during orientation and follow all camp policies
  • Keep spiritually and physically prepared to minister
  • Become familiar with the camp and grounds

SPECIFIC R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Maintain a vital personal growing relationship with Jesus Christ
  • Attend lifeguard training and perform duties
  • Obey and enforce all camp rules and policies   
  • Run activity sites according to Grace procedures including (but not limited to):
  • Ranges: Slingshots, archery, pellet guns, 22’s, shotguns, laser tag
  • Waterfront: Boating, swimming, blobbing, other water activities
  • High Adventure: Climbing tower, ropes course, zip line, etc.
  • Outdoor activities: Biking, group games, ga-ga ball
  • Cooperatives and Teambuilding
  • Campfires
  • Organize, repair, and inventory program equipment
  • Attend staff meetings
  • Host guests according to Grace Adventures foot washing philosophy
  • Assist with accommodations: cleaning showers, bathrooms, and buildings to meet standards of excellence
  • Host Meals: set-up, manage, and communicate with campers, families, and groups
  • Support Community Worship as assigned
  • Other duties as assigned by your supervisor(s)

POSITION TYPE: Seasonal

HOUSING & MEALS: Provided through contract dates

Requirements

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Have a personal growing relationship with Jesus Christ
  • Love for kids and adults and the ability to communicate with them
  • Good health and stamina as required to implement a summer camp program. This will involve long hours and lifting at times. Ability to work in various weather climates and conditions.
  • Willing and teachable attitude 
  • Team-based mindset
  • Minimum age 17
  • Education required: High School Degree or equivalent
  • Valid Driver’s License
